Ingredients
Estimated total cost: €4.92 · €2.46/serving
- 2 tablespoons of extra virgin olive oilEst. price €0.12–€0.30
- 1 large onion, quartered and thinly sliced (for even cooking, make sure to slice the onion thinly and uniformly)Est. price €0.40–€0.80
- One 16-ounce tub of firm or extra-firm tofu (pat dry the tofu with paper towels to remove excess moisture before cooking)Est. price €1.80–€3.50
- One 8-ounce package of seitan, cut into bite-size strips (sear the seitan in a hot pan for a delicious texture)Est. price €2.50–€4.50
- 2 scallions, minced (use both the white and green parts for added flavor and color)Est. price €0.10–€0.25
- Easy Gravy (feel free to adjust the consistency of the gravy by adding more or less liquid)Est. price €0.00–€0.00
Steps
- 1In a wide skillet, heat 1 tablespoon of oil over medium-low heat. Sauté the onion until it starts to brown slightly, stirring regularly to ensure even cooking.
- 2Begin by slicing the tofu into 6 slabs horizontally. Pat dry thoroughly using paper towels or clean tea towels, then proceed to cut each slab into strips.
Cultural note
Tofu and seitan are staples in vegetarian and vegan diets, often used as meat substitutes. This dish showcases the versatility of plant-based proteins in creating flavorful and satisfying meals. The use of easy gravy adds a comforting element to the dish, making it a popular choice in vegetarian cooking.

Health note
Savory Grilled Tofu and Seitan Medley is a nutritious option, providing a good source of plant-based protein with 30g per serving. It is also high in fiber (4g) and low in sugar (3g). However, the dish is relatively high in fat (24g) and sodium (600mg), which should be considered for those monitoring their intake.
